Suppose there are three power-generating plants, each of which has access to 5 different production processes. The table below summarizes the cost of each production process and the corresponding number of tons of smoke emitted each.  Process  A  B  C  D  E  (smoke/day)   (4 tons/day)   (3 tons/day)   (2 tons/day)  (1 ton/day)   (0 tons/day)   Cost to Firm X($/ day)  $500$514$530$555$585 Cost to Firm Y ($/day)  $400$420$445$480$520 Cost to Firm Z($/day)  $300$325$360$400$550\begin{array}{|c|c|c|c|c|c|}\hline \text { Process } & \text { A } & \text { B } & \text { C } & \text { D } & \text { E } \\\text { (smoke/day) } & \text { (4 tons/day) } & \text { (3 tons/day) } & \text { (2 tons/day) } & (1 \text { ton/day) } & \text { (0 tons/day) } \\\hline \text { Cost to Firm } X(\$ / \text { day) } & \$ 500 & \$ 514 & \$ 530 & \$ 555 & \$ 585 \\\hline \text { Cost to Firm Y (\$/day) } & \$ 400 & \$ 420 & \$ 445 & \$ 480 & \$ 520 \\\hline \text { Cost to Firm Z(\$/day) } & \$ 300 & \$ 325 & \$ 360 & \$ 400 & \$ 550 \\\hline\end{array}
Suppose the government decides to impose a tax on each ton of smoke emitted. What would be the lowest tax, in whole dollars, that would reduce emissions to 6 tons per day?
